Transaction 758c91fd5026de2b0d84d12a7be6f5ffca6e56e4c7a8cf844e84e8448f448e3e
1 Input
2 Outputs
- 758c91fd5026de2b0d84d12a7be6f5ffca6e56e4c7a8cf844e84e8448f448e3e:0
- 758c91fd5026de2b0d84d12a7be6f5ffca6e56e4c7a8cf844e84e8448f448e3e:1
value 679579
address 1HFiFQUQ8dDKpEiP5K74E1WrwMz1WoNC6F
value 1434000
address 34ZxMWRQNF7xScZgboqTEtDkrnKxkaQKcA